
UBT, EA and NUCLIO are the founding members of the European School Innovation Academy (ESIA) which is already offering a platform for teachers to participate in professional development activities, webinars or share guidelines and material on innovative school practices. SYNAPSES will use ESIA to promote its activities and good practices, also in the field of environmental awareness or addressing climate change. The project will take advantage of a network exceeding 10.000 teachers that ESIA is able to reach out to and invite them to summer schools and online webinars to create their own projects and initiatives based on the concepts and principles of the SYNAPSES Standard-Based Training Framework. The SYNAPSES Academy training programme will capitalise on the results of numerous initiatives that have been designed to facilitate the development of sustainability citizenship. These initiatives will be adopted and enriched to form the SYNAPSES training ecosystem. An indicative list of such initiatives is following:

HORIZON 2020: SCHOOLS AS LIVING LABS
The project engages in dialogue school communities, research institutions, science museums and centres and spaces of open-learning. The Living Lab approach highlights the co-design and co-development of valuable learning experiences. In the framework of SYNAPSES, pilot activities following the living lab approach will be designed and implemented in the participating institutions.

Better awareness of the opportunities, benefits and limitations of nature-based solutions has been identified by citizens and experts as one of the main factors that could facilitate the transition to more sustainable cities and territories. Nature-based Solutions (NBS) use nature and ecosystems to deliver social, ecological and economic benefits, increasing biodiversity and contributing to climate change adaptation and mitigation. However, the educational potential of NBS remains largely unexplored, whilst innovative programmes and resources around NBS are currently missing from formal and informal education programmes for children and families. In the framework of SYNAPSES, the platform will be used for educational activities around exemplars in schools and sustainability citizenship (WP4).
